Artificial Hells: Participatory Art and the Politics of Spectatorship
info About this book
A critical examination of participatory art from the 1990s to the present, questioning the ethics and aesthetics of socially engaged practice.
format_quote Why I Recommend It
Bishop challenges us to think critically about what makes participatory art meaningful. Not everyone will agree, but it is essential reading.
— Stella Barnes
